Overview
Razorfish is looking for a hands-on, hybrid editor and videographer to be part of a brand-new team crafting social media content solutions for a high-profile client. This is a new endeavor, breaking traditional agency norms for how an agency can and should work with clients. You will be immersed in the client’s day-to-day with a bespoke agency team crafted to support the owned organic social handles for a multi-brand client. You can expect to work alongside a diverse team of creators utilizing a vast library of proprietary assets to create engaging, thumb-stopping, buzz-generating social content. Role will involve high-volume content execution working directly with client and agency teams to elevate the social media experience of our client while also increasing followers across multiple high-visibility branded accounts.
Responsibilities
- Social First Mentality
Up to date on the latest tools and trends within social media platforms.
Edit video footage into high-quality content for various social media platforms.
Strong video production & still photography skills using DSLR and iPhone cameras.
Manage post-production tasks including color grading, sound editing, and ability to troubleshoot tech specs and delivery issues.
Functionally report to Agency Producer who will assign and manage priority shoots and edits.
